Output ec130869beb303043c6165a5a754a86ad75a5aa65c5143b323b782a21466d207:9

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61490305d58bf7f0692c279d99dd687dafe5bb7907d04809085a95dd8a97f0bb
address
bc1pv9ysxpw430mlq6fvy7wenhtg0kh7twmeqlgyszggt22amz5h7zasucuv6p
transaction
ec130869beb303043c6165a5a754a86ad75a5aa65c5143b323b782a21466d207
spent
true